> phpMyAdmin is intended to handle the adminstration of MySQL 
> over the web. Currently it can:
> 
> - create and drop databases
> - create, copy, drop and alter tables
> - delete, edit and add fields
> - execute any SQL-statement, even batch-queries
> - manage keys on fields
> - load text files into tables
> - create and read dumps of tables
> - export data to CSV values
> - administer multiple servers and single databases
